#include<bits/stdc++.h>
using namespace std;
int main(){
  int i,j,n,x=0,m;
  int c[10][10];
  float s=0;
  int a[10][10];
  cin>>n>>m;
  for(i=0;i<n;i++)
  	for(j=0;j<m;j++) cin>>a[i][j];
  for(i=0;i<n;i++)
  	for(j=0;j<m;j++) cin>>c[i][j];
  for(i=0;i<n;i++){
  	for(j=0;j<m;j++){
  		if(a[i][j]=c[i][j]) x++;
  		}
  }
  x=x*100;
  s=n*m*1.0;
  printf("%.2f",x/s);	
  return 0;
}
/**************************************************************
	Problem: 1407
	User: wtq001
	Language: C++
	Result: Wrong Answer
****************************************************************/